Lieutenant General Attila Géza Takács
12:14 June 6, 2023Date of rank: 15. March 2020
Personal information:
- Date of birth: 27. April 1968. Miskolc
- Family Status: married, one child
- Nationality: Hungarian
Studies:
- 2015 NATO Defense College
- 2008 NATO School (CREVAL)
- 2006-2007 Military Senior Leader course at the Zrínyi Miklós National Defense University
- 1997-1999 Zrínyi Miklós National Defense University
- 1992 COY Leader Course in Switzerland
- 1986-1989 Kossuth Lajos Military College in Szentendre - mechanized infantry faculty
Deployments:
- 2011-2013 Hungarian Defence Forces, National Military Representative, (Colonel) - MONS (Belgium)
- 2001-2002 HDF KFOR Guard and Security Battalion in Pristina commander (Lieutenant Colonel)
Military Career:
- 2023 – Deputy Chief of Defence Staff
- 2022 – 2023 Defence Attaché (Major General) London
- 2020 – 2022 Hungarian Defence Forces Command, Army Inspectorate, Inspector (Major General) - Budapest
- 2016 – 2019 Hungarian Defence Forces, Military Augmentation, Preparation and Training Command, Commander (Brigadier General) - Budapest
- 2013 – 2016 Hungarian Defence Forces, 5th Bocskai István Infantry Brigade, Commander (Brigadier General) - Debrecen
- 2010 – 2013 Hungarian Defence Forces, National Military Representative, SHAPE Deputy of National Military Representative (Colonel) - MONS (Belgium)
- 2008 – 2010 Hungarian Defence Forces Joint Force Command, Chief J3/J7, (Colonel) - Székesfehérvár
- 2005 – 2007 Hungarian Defence Forces 5th “Bocskai István” Light Infantry Brigade, Chief of Staff (Colonel) - Debrecen
- 2003 – 2005 Hungarian Defence Forces 5th “Bocskai István” Light Infantry Brigade, DCOS OPS (Lieutenant Colonel) – Debrecen
- 1999 – 2002 Hungarian Defence Forces 5th “Bocskai István” Mechanized Infantry Brigade Chief G-3 (Major) – Debrecen
- 1995 – 1997 Hungarian Defence Forces 5th “Bocskai István” Mechanized Infantry Brigade, Battalion Commander (Captain) – Debrecen
- 1990 – 1995 Mechanized Brigade, Company Commander (1st Lieutenant) – Mezőtúr, Debrecen
- 1989 – 1990 Mechanized Brigade, Platoon Leader (2nd Lieutenant) - Nagykanizsa
Medals and Decorations:
- 2020 “Ehrenkreuz der Bundeswehr” Gold grade
- 2019 “Legion of Merit” (USA)
- 2016 Order of Merit of the Hungarian Republic Knight’s Cross
- 2013 NATO Service Medal
- 2007 Service Decoration for Merit decorated with laurel wreath
- 2000-2004 Service Decoration for Merit Gold, Silver, Bronze grade
- 2002 Service Medal for Peacekeeping (KOSOVO)
- 1996, 2006, 2016 Officer’s Service Decoration (I. II. III)
Foreign languages:
- English: STANAG 3333
- German: Intermediate „A”
